GFRP锚杆锚固机理试验研究

摘    要:为了深入研究GFRP锚杆的锚固机理,模拟实际情况制作了试验模型,进行了拉拔试验.通过对实验结果的分析和研究,获得了砂浆粘结GFRP锚杆在拉拔条件下沿杆体的轴力和剪应力分布规律以及随荷载增大的演化过程,对荷载传递的机理进行了讨论,可为同类研究参考.

关 键 词:GFRP锚杆  锚固机理  剪应力  轴力

Experimental Study on Anchoring Mechanism of GFRP Bolt

Abstract:In order to study the GFRP bolt's anchoring mechanism deeply,the experiment model is manufactured by simulating the fact circs,and the drawing test under the jack load is carried out.Based on researching and analyzing the experimental result,regularities of distribution of axial force and shear stress of the mortar bond GFRP bolt,and the evolutionary with the increase of load are obtained,the theory of load transfer mechanism is discussed.It is a reference for the similar research.
Keywords:GFRP bolt  anchoring mechanism  shear stress  axial stress
